Job Raising
 

Since IAESTE is a reciprocal exchange program it is essential that we raise jobs here in Minnesota so that our students can also go abroad. There are a variety of ways that members can become involved in the job raising efforts of the local committee. The most successful method is to ask someone with whom you have already established a personal relationship (internship adviser, professor, family member, etc.) Other ways to help out include sending out emails, making calls to local companies, and meeting with prospective employers.
